  • FIELD
  • The present invention relates to garments. More particularly, the present invention relates to adjustable garments configured to expose and cover human toes.
  • BACKGROUND
  • As shown in FIG. 1, a typical garment 10 comprises a toe portion 12, a heel portion 16, an ankle portion 18 and an elastic cuff portion 19 formed integrally with the upper end of the ankle portion 18. The heel portion 16 is joined to the toe portion 12 by a generally tubular body portion 15. The typical garment 10 is a closed toe garment that encloses wearer's toes.
  • Although a wide variety of garments are available for allowing adult toes to be uncovered from time to time, for different reasons, none of them are specifically designed for babies. As babies grow, they love exploring their environment and play with their surroundings. As part of their exploration, babies love to discover and play with their toes. Unfortunately, the traditional socks (as shown in FIG. 1) require parents to remove the socks from the babies feet before the baby can play with their toes. This causes the babies feet to get cold and socks to get lost.
  • In view of the limitation in prior art, a need exists for improved adjustable garments configured to expose and cover human toes.

  • Referring to FIG. 2a , according to some embodiments presently disclosed, a garment 20 comprises an open toe portion 25 and an ankle portion 35. According to some embodiments presently disclosed, the garment 20 further comprises an elastic cuff portion 40 formed integrally with the upper end of the ankle portion 35 so that the garment 20 stays in position against the skin of the wearer. According to some embodiments presently disclosed, the garment 20 comprises a heel portion 30. According to some embodiments presently disclosed, the heel portion 30 is joined to the open toe portion 25 by a generally tubular body portion 45.
  • In some embodiments, the open toe portion 25 is needle stitched to provide clean finish without raw edges.
  • According to some embodiments presently disclosed, the garment 20 comprises one or more non-skid grippers (not shown) coupled with a lower portion of the tubular body portion 45. In some embodiments, the non-skid grippers comprise silicone material, rubber material and/or any other type of material configured to prevent wearer of the garment 20 from slipping on the floor while walking/running.
  • According to some embodiments presently disclosed, the open toe portion 25 comprises an upper edge 90, disposed above wearer's toes 60. According to some embodiments presently disclosed, the open toe portion 25 further comprises a lower edge 95, disposed under wearer's toes 60. According to some embodiments presently disclosed, the upper edge 90 and the lower edge 95 define an opening 50 to accommodate the wearer's toes 60.
  • According to some embodiments presently disclosed, the garment 20 comprises an elastic cuff portion 1.30 (shown in FIG. 2C) formed integrally with the tubular body portion 45 adjacent to the toe portion 25 so that the garment 20 stays in position against the skin of the wearer. Although FIG. 2C shows the elastic cuff portion 130 completely surrounding the opening 50, it is to be understood that, in some embodiments, the elastic cuff portion 130 surrounds only a portion of the opening 50.
  • Referring to FIG. 2b , according to some embodiments presently disclosed, the garment 20 further comprises a movable cover portion 55. According to some embodiments presently disclosed, the movable cover portion 55 comprises a first surface 100; a second surface 105 (shown in FIG. 3) disposed opposite the first surface 100; a first edge 65; a second edge 70 disposed substantially parallel the first edge 65; a third edge 75 disposed substantially perpendicular to the first edge 65 and the second edge 70; and a fourth edge 80 disposed substantially parallel the third edge 75.
  • According to some embodiments presently disclosed, the movable cover portion 55 comprises one or more non-skid grippers (not shown) coupled with a first surface 100. According to some embodiments presently disclosed, the movable cover portion 55 comprises one or more non-skid grippers (not shown) coupled with a second surface 105. In some embodiments, the non-skid grippers comprise silicone material, rubber material and/or any other type of material configured to prevent wearer of the garment 20 from slipping on the floor while walking/running.
  • According to some embodiments presently disclosed, the movable cover portion 55 is coupled with the tubular body portion 45 as shown in FIGS. 3-6. The movable cover portion 55 is configured to move from a closed position where wearer's toes 60 are covered (as shown in FIG. 3) to an open position where wearer's toes 60 are uncovered (as shown in FIGS. 4-5) and vice-versa.
  • According to some embodiments presently disclosed, the movable cover portion 55 is coupled with the tubular body portion 45 as follows: the second edge 70 of the movable cover portion 55 is coupled with at least a portion of the lower edge 95. The second edge 70 may be coupled with at least a portion of the lower edge 95 using, for example, stitching 115 (shown in FIGS. 3-5), heat sealing (not shown), adhesive material, ultrasonic sealing (not shown) or the like. The third edge 75 of the movable cover portion 55 is coupled with at least a portion of the tubular body portion 45. The third edge 75 may be coupled with at least a portion of the tubular body portion 45 using, for example, stitching 110 (shown in FIGS. 3-6), heat sealing (not shown), adhesive material, ultrasonic sealing (not shown) or the like. The fourth edge 80 of the movable cover portion 55 is coupled with at least a portion of the tubular body portion 45. The fourth edge 80 may be coupled with at least a portion of the tubular body portion 45 using, for example, stitching 120 (shown in FIGS. 5-6), heat sealing (not shown), adhesive material, ultrasonic sealing (not shown) or the like. In some embodiments, the movable cover portion 55 covers the entire front width of the tabular body portion 45. In some embodiments, the movable cover portion 55 is sewn onto the tubular body portion 45 using a single needle edge stitch to provide clean finish without any exposed seam.
  • Referring to FIGS. 3-5, according to some embodiments presently disclosed, the stitching 110 and 120 are substantially perpendicular to the opening 50. Referring to FIGS. 3-5, according to some embodiments, the stitching 110 and 120 are substantially parallel to each other.
  • Referring to FIGS. 3, according to some embodiments presently disclosed, the movable cover portion 55 is positioned in the closed position where wearer's toes 60 are covered, According to some embodiments presently disclosed, a portion of the surface 100 of the movable cover portion 55 is in contact with an upper portion of the tubular body portion 45 while the movable cover portion 55 is in the closed position as shown in FIG. 3. To expose the wearer's toes 60, the first edge 65 is pulled in a direction away from the ankle portion 35 towards the toes 60. Once the toes 60 are exposed, the movable cover portion 55 is placed in the open position shown in FIGS. 4-5. According to some embodiments presently disclosed, a portion of the second surface 105 of the movable cover portion 55 is in contact with a lower portion of the tubular body portion 45 while the movable cover portion 55 is in the open position as shown in FIGS. 4-5. To cover the toes 60, the first edge 65 is pulled in a direction away from the heel portion 30 towards the toes 60. Once the toes 60 are covered, the movable cover portion 55 is placed in the closed position shown in FIG. 3.

  • According to some embodiments presently disclosed, an exemplary manufacturing process 300 for the garment 20 is shown in FIG. 17. At 310, a substantially tubular shaped material is provided. In some embodiments, the substantially tubular material comprises an open toe portion 25 and an ankle portion 35 (as shown, for example, in FIG. 2A). In some embodiments, the substantially tubular shaped material optionally comprises an elastic cuff portion 40 formed integrally with the upper end of the ankle portion 35 so that the substantially tubular shaped material stays in position against the skin of the wearer (as shown, for example, in FIG. 2A). According to some embodiments presently disclosed, the substantially tubular shaped material further comprises a heel portion 30 joined to the open toe portion 25 by a generally tubular body portion 45 (as shown, for example, in FIG. 2A). In some embodiments, the substantially tubular shaped material is manufactured using, for example, a knitting machine. In some embodiments, a knitting machine knits in a circular spiral to form the substantially tubular shaped material. In some embodiments, a knitting machine forms the elastic cuff portion 40 by knitting in a circular spiral and feeding in rubber yam. When the elastic cuff portion 40 is completed, in some embodiments, the knitting machine forms the ankle portion 35 by knitting in a circular spiral. When the ankle portion 35 is completed, in some embodiments, the knitting machine forms the heel portion 30 by alternating knitting directions and making ½ rotations of the knitting cylinders associated with the knitting machine. When the heel portion 30 is completed, in some embodiments, the knitting machine forms the body portion 45 by knitting in the circular spiral until it forms the toe portion 25. In some embodiments, the knitting machine forms the elastic cuff portion 130 after it forms the body portion 45.
  • According to some embodiments, the knitting machine is a Single Cylinder knitting machine known in the art. According to some embodiments, the knitting machine is a Double Cylinder knitting machine known in the art.
  • In some embodiments, one or more non-skid grippers are coupled with the substantially tubular shaped material. In some embodiments, the one or more non-skid grippers comprise silicone material, rubber material and/or any other type of material configured to prevent wearer of the substantially tubular shaped material from slipping on the floor while walking/running. In some embodiments, the one or more non-skid grippers are screen printed onto the substantially tubular shaped material. In some embodiments, the one or more non-skid grippers are adhesively coupled with the substantially tubular shaped material.
  • At 320, a movable cover 55 is coupled with the substantially tubular shaped material. In some embodiments, the movable cover 55 is a piece of fabric. In some embodiments, the movable cover 55 is a piece of fabric that is folded over before being coupled with the substantially tubular shaped material to provide a clean finished edge 65. In some embodiments, the movable cover 55 is sewn to the substantially tubular shaped material.
  • In some embodiments, one or more non-skid grippers are coupled with the movable cover 55. In some embodiments, the one or more non-skid grippers comprise silicone material, rubber material and/or any other type of material configured to prevent wearer of the substantially tubular shaped material from slipping on the floor while walking/running. In some embodiments, the one or more non-skid grippers are screen printed onto the movable cover 55. In some embodiments, the one or more non-skid grippers are adhesively coupled with the movable cover 55.
  • In some embodiments presently disclosed, the substantially tubular shaped material and/or portions of the substantially tubular shaped material comprise cotton, cotton poly blend, acrylic, spandex and/or polyester material. In some embodiments, the movable cover comprises cotton, poly, spandex, and/or acrylic.

  • Contrary to the prior art, the garments presently described offer babies freedom to explore their toes—while still wearing socks. Contrary to the prior art, the garments presently described also allow the toddlers to crawl, stand and take their first steps. Using the presently described garments, toddlers are able to use the natural traction of their toes to help them crawl, stand, and take their first steps without slipping—like they do all the time in their traditional socks.
